Perched above the iconic Sunset Strip, this stunning contemporary home was the last estate purchased by the legendary Stan Lee, the creator of Marvel Comics. Nestled in the prestigious Bird Streets, this expansive single-story home encompasses over 5,200 square feet on a sprawling half-acre lot. Upon entering, you're greeted by a striking foyer that flows into a cozy den featuring a built-in bar and fireplace, an elegant formal living room, and a spacious dining area ideal for hosting large gatherings. After dinner, unwind in the state-of-the-art movie theater, complete with plush seating for ten or more and its own ensuite bathroom. The luxurious primary suite is a true retreat, offering two oversized walk-in closets, dual bathrooms, a fireplace, and a private sauna. Two additional bedroom suites and a dedicated office round out the interior, ensuring ample space for relaxation and creativity. An entertainer's dream, the grand chef's kitchen seamlessly leads to the sparkling pool, spa, and cabana. The upper paved deck, known for hosting legendary intimate concerts, provides a unique outdoor space to savor the California lifestyle. This is a rare opportunity to own a storied residence that beautifully blends luxury, creativity, and the quintessential indoor-outdoor living experience.
